SPIN E-Bike Rate Changes Coming to Millbrae
Millbrae's SPIN Electric Bike Share Program will implement a new unified pricing structure beginning September 1st, 2025. Starting next month, all rides will cost $1.00 to unlock plus $0.42 per minute, regardless of the day of the week. This replaces the previous system that offered different rates for weekdays versus weekends.
The updated pricing will appear in the SPIN mobile application, and users must accept the revised terms before unlocking any bike after the implementation date. For income-qualified residents, reduced rates remain available through the SPIN Access program, ensuring cost barriers don't prevent participation in Millbrae's green transportation initiative.
Both Millbrae and Burlingame are actively pursuing additional grant funding opportunities to help subsidize SPIN rides in the future.
